Abstract

A surgical mask includes a hooded cover unit including a head cover and a shoulder cover, the head cover fully covering the head of a user and having an opening for opening a predetermined area aroundan eye, the nose, and the mouth of the face of the user, and the shoulder cover extended from the head cover, for covering the neck and a shoulder of the user, a fixing unit including a U-shaped support frame and an elastic band, the support frame disposed inside the hooded cover unit and extended curvedly along left and right sides of the head, and the elastic band connected to both ends of thesupport frame and extended along a front and rear of the head, a rotation frame engaged rotatably with both ends of the support frame, disposed outside the head cover, and extended curvedly along a front of the face, and a transparent cover shield mounted to the rotation frame, for covering an upper part of the face. When the rotation frame is at a first position, the transparent cover shield is disposed at a position corresponding to the face of the user and covers the opening of the head cover, and when the rotation frame is at a second position by upward rotation, the transparent cover shield exposes a part of the opening.

Description

technical field

[0001] The present invention relates to surgical face masks, and more particularly, to a method for maximally limiting the body exposure of the user (medical personnel), while keeping the user and the patient safe from viruses in the surgical environment, in a body that limits exposure A portion of the area vents air to provide the user with a cool surgical mask. Background technique

[0002] In general, a mouth mask is worn to prevent saliva from being splashed from the mouth of a medical worker to a patient during a medical operation or a surgical operation. Oral masks of prior art such as figure 1 As shown, it includes: a jaw support 20, which supports the user's jaw; a cover 10, which is made of a transparent film material; and a fixing part 30, which is used to fix both ends of the cover 10 to the user's ears.
